This straightforward 129.2-mile drive from Grimes to Cedar Rapids, Iowa, is easily manageable as a single-day trip, taking approximately 2 hours and 37 minutes. With a modest fuel cost estimated at $20, it's an economical option for exploring the Midwest. The route primarily utilizes local roads like Lincoln Highway, Northeast Hubbell Road, and 73rd Street, offering a connected, turn-heavy local experience rather than an interstate cruise. You'll find this drive to be a practical way to get from point A to point B within Iowa, with only one recommended stop to break up the journey.

Expect a 'turn-heavy local drive' for this 129.2-mile journey through Iowa. While only 17% of the route is on highways, you'll encounter a longest stretch of 37 miles on the historic Lincoln Highway, offering a more continuous segment. The road's personality is defined by its local roads, which means a more engaged driving experience with frequent turns and intersections. This isn't a high-speed interstate cruise; instead, it's a drive where you'll feel more connected to the landscape as you navigate through towns and rural areas.
